The E1 Treaty Trader Visa enables people or employees of businesses to enter the United States of America to carry out international trade.
The processing time of E1 Visa tends to vary by consulate. It will also depend on whether you are making the application from outside or within the United States. On average, the entire processing time takes up to 2-4 weeks.
The E1 Visa is known to offer a grant for staying for around 2 years. It can be followed by an extension of around 2 years. There is no limitation on the total number of extensions.
E1 Visa holders can consider traveling outside the United States. Upon re-entry, they will automatically receive a two-year extension automatically.

The E-2 visa is a non-immigrant visa for nationals of countries with which the United States maintains a treaty of commerce and navigation. It allows individuals to enter the U.S. to develop and direct the operations of an enterprise in which they have invested, or are actively in the process of investing, a substantial amount of capital.
The L-1A visa is a non-immigrant visa for intracompany transferees who work in managerial or executive positions. It allows multinational companies to transfer their executives and managers from a foreign office to an office in the United States, or to establish a new office in the U.S.
It is also possible for employees to arrive at the United States of America under the E1 Visa provisions for trade purposes. They should meet the following conditions: The employee should be a citizen of the treaty country Should be involved in some supervisory or managerial role requiring specialist knowledge or skills
